Summary "Harald Niederreiter's pioneering research in the field of applied algebra and number theory has led to important and substantial breakthroughs in many areas, including finite fields and their application areas as coding theory and cryptography as well as uniform distribution and quasi-Monte Carlo methods. He is author of more than 350 research papers and 10 books"-- Provided by publisher.
Survey articles on modern topics related to the work of Harald Niederreiter, written by close colleagues and leading experts.
